Last week, my wife had invited a guy from her old highschool, whom she only knew from Facebook. Much to her surprise, he showed up, and ended up being the life of the party. Turns out he was a multi-sport athlete who ended up playing baseball for Mississippi State and was a minor leaguer for a few years (he's in his 50s now).

While he was still in highschool, he was being recruited as a football player (a sport he had the skills to play but never liked). Pat Dye came on a recruiting visit his senior year and they got to talking. He was telling Dye about the challenges he faced getting a college education (came from a broken home, education wasn't valued in his family, etc).

Dye told him to remember one thing: "Half the people you meet in life won't care about your problems - and the other half will be glad you got 'em."

He said that ever since Dye said that, he'd been a Pat Dye fan.
